I do not want my service station operator to be jumped on when we say you did not get the 4.3-cent reduction tomorrow or next week. It is at the rack. So I am trying to protect them. My figures--and I always stand corrected because somebody will find a way to get at me with words--but under the Republican Budget Committee's mark yesterday, taxes will increase more over the next 6 years than they did over the past 6 years. Think about that: $415 billion. Under the Republican budget chairman's mark advertised yesterday, taxes will increase more over the next 6 years than they have over the past 6 years. That is $415 billion, if I figure that right. Everybody will say, well, the economy is increasing and all that stuff. If it is increasing, give this administration some credit.
